2.37 – The Role of Posture in Strength Expression: Posture affects how force travels through the body. Poor posture can limit strength even when muscles are strong. Rounded shoulders, weak hips, or unstable feet reduce power output. Proper alignment allows muscles to work together instead of against each other. Fixing posture often improves lifts without adding weight. Posture also protects joints by spreading load evenly. Small changes in stance or bar position can unlock immediate strength gains. Many injuries come from force leaking through poor alignment. Training posture improves balance, control, and confidence under load. Postural work is not separate from strength work, it supports it. This lesson teaches awareness of body position in every lift. When posture improves, strength feels smoother and safer.
